Career
Akshata Murthy’s career trajectory has been impressive, to say the least. After completing her MBA at Stanford, she dived into the world of business, taking on leadership roles that would prepare her for her future ventures.
She first worked at Tendris, a Dutch cleantech firm, as a marketing chief. But it was in 2009 when Akshata took a leap into the fashion world, launching her own fashion line. The company was a success in its own right, and later, Akshata Designs was acquired by Aditya Birla Group, marking a successful exit. Afterward, she took on the role of director at Catamaran Ventures, which she helped grow into a significant player in the investment scene.
Throughout her career, Akshata has also served on boards of organizations such as Claremont McKenna College and the San Francisco Exploratorium, showcasing her commitment to education and cultural development.
Career, Achievements, and Success Journey
While Akshata’s fashion label and philanthropic work are the highlights of her career, they’re certainly not all she has to her name. She’s an active investor, with a stake in several well-known businesses, including Digme Fitness, Wendy’s in India, and Koro Kids. She also has an involvement in two Jamie Oliver restaurants, which further solidifies her presence in the international business scene.
Her experience as a businesswoman doesn’t just stop with her investments; it extends to the venture capital world, where she’s been an influential player since 2012. Akshata’s background in entrepreneurship has allowed her to build a broad portfolio, and her investments have given her opportunities to diversify her wealth while supporting innovative companies across various industries. As an investor, she’s shown that her interest in business goes beyond fashion—it’s about finding opportunities to grow and create something bigger.
Her involvement with Infosys, even indirectly, continues to be significant. As a minority shareholder in Infosys, Akshata remains tied to her family’s business empire, though she’s taken on a much more hands-off approach compared to her father.
